Definition and Importance

Measures of central tendency are defined as statistical methods used to describe the central or typical value of a dataset, including the mean, median, and mode. These measures are important because they provide a summary of the data, allowing for easier comparison and analysis. The definition of each measure is crucial in understanding its importance, with the mean being the average value, the median being the middle value, and the mode being the most frequent value. Formula and Examples

The formula for calculating the mean is the sum of all values divided by the total number of values, which can be expressed as mean = (x1 + x2 + … + xn) / n, where x represents each value and n represents the total number of values.

For example, if we have a set of numbers 2, 4, 6, 8, and 10, we can calculate the mean by adding these numbers together and dividing by the total count, which is 5, resulting in a mean of 6.

Definition and Calculation

The median is a measure of central tendency that is defined as the middle value in a data set when the numbers are arranged in order. To calculate the median, the data set is first arranged in order from smallest to largest. If the data set has an odd number of values, the median is the middle value. If the data set has an even number of values, the median is the average of the two middle values. Definition and Examples

Measures of central tendency are defined as statistical methods used to describe the central or typical value of a dataset. The mode is one such measure, which is the value that appears most frequently in a dataset. For example, in a dataset of exam scores, the mode would be the score that occurs most often.
